118 BPM — squarely in hip-hop territory, mixable within roughly 113–123 BPM without pitch artefacts.
G Minor — 6A on the Camelot wheel. Harmonically compatible with 6B, 5A and 7A.
Tracks in 6A, 6B, 5A or 7A between ~113–123 BPM.
Groove sustainer — 53% energy with a steady groove keeps momentum without forcing the energy up. Ideal in the stretches between peaks.
